Article: FEELING STRESSED? TRY LITTLE T'AI CHI THROUGH KISHWAUKEE COLLEGE

MALTA, Ill., Feb. 9 -- Kishwaukee College issued the following news release:

Tim Griffin came to T'ai Chi, the ancient Chinese martial arts exercise, by an extraordinary path: music. "As a musician, I learned different breathing techniques for wind instruments and then carried those through into meditative breathing exercises," he said. "I found my way to T'ai Chi about nine years ago." Griffin now teaches various classes in T'ai Chi for the Kishwaukee College Continuing Education department. Beginners' classes start February 21 and continuing classes for students with T'ai Chi experience begin February 19; there are also two classes for older adults that begin February 17 at Oak Crest and ...
